PANews reported on January 5th that, according to Cyvers Alerts, multiple suspicious transactions involving proxy contracts were detected on Arbitrum (ARB), with an estimated loss of approximately $1.5 million. Preliminary analysis indicates that a single deployer of the USDGambit and TLP projects may have lost access to their accounts. The attacker then deployed a new contract and updated the proxy administrator (ProxyAdmin) privileges to gain control. The stolen funds were subsequently bridged to the Ethereum network and deposited into Tornado Cash.
